Here's How to Freeze Steak.

STEP 1. Label the freezer bag with today's date, how many and what is in the bag. You may also want to put a “USE BY” date that is 6 months to 1 year from now. 

*** Use a sharpie marker for the best result labeling your freezer bag. If you don't have a sharpie, a regular ink pen will work***

hand writing on a plastic bag with a sharpie marker

STEP 2. Place the Steaks Into the Freezer Bag

***Make SURE that you have purchased "FREEZER" bags and not simply storage bags. The freezer bags are made specifically for storing food in the freezer.***

hand placing a ribeye steak into a zip lock freezer bag

STEP 3. Close the freezer bag and squeeze out as much air as you can.

***Leaving air in the bag increases your risk for freezer burn PLUS it takes up more room in your freezer***

two hands sealing a zipper top resealable bag

How To Freeze Steak

To freeze steaks, first place the steaks into the freezer bag and lay them as flat as possible. Squeeze out as much air from the bag as you can. Label the freezer bag with today's date, how many and what is in the bag. You may want to put a “USE BY” date for 6 months to 1 year from now.

Frequently Asked Questions About How To Freeze Steak

Can You Freeze Raw Steak? 

Yes! You can freeze raw steak and it only takes a few minutes to do! So, the next time you find steak on sale or you are not going to be able to eat the meat you bought!

Simply put it in a freezer bag, label it and put it in the freezer! It IS BEST to know the quality of the meat you are freezing, the best meat will make the best frozen meat!

How Long Can You Keep Meat in the Freezer? 

Frozen meat is generally good for 4 months - 1 year, however, according to the USDA, meat kept at 0 degrees is good indefinitely. To be safe though, I don’t keep meat for more than a year and I check it for freezer burn before using if I know its been in there for a while! 

Is It Safe To Eat Two Year Old Frozen Meat?

That really depends on how well the meat has been wrapped, how much air is in the package and how steady the temp has been in the freezer. If the meat has been kept solidly at 0 degrees, then it should be fine. If you notice many ice crystals, it is probably time to throw it out. 

Can You Freeze Cooked Steak? 

Yes! Absolutely you can freeze a cooked steak. Cooked beef is basically unchanged when it is thawed and reheated. It is the same procedure as the raw steak. Make sure to label your package and use it in the next 6 months or so.

How To Freeze Cooked Steak

Use the same procedure as freezing a raw steak, put the steak in a freezer bag, remove as much air as possible and label the bag. Freeze for up to 6 months. 

Do I Salt Steak Before Freezing? 

You do NOT need to salt steak before freezing. When you thaw the steak, then you will want to salt it or marinate it or do whatever preparations you usually do to your steak before cooking it. 

Does Freezing Steak Make It Tough? 

Freezing does not make your steak tough. Freezing it does not tenderize it either though so, whatever quality of steak you start with is the quality of steak that you will end up with. 

How Long Can You Freeze Steak

You can freeze steak, if handled properly and kept at the right temperature for a year. 

How To Thaw Steak

To thaw steak,

  1. Fill a large bowl or a clean kitchen sink with tepid (room temperature) water.
  2. Place the frozen steak in a ziplock style bag. Place the steak filled bag into the water.
  3. Turn the steaks over every 10 minutes and replace the water if it becomes cold.
  4. The steaks will thaw in about 20-40 minutes depending how thick they are. 30 minutes is about right. 

Does Freezing Steak Affect the Taste? 

Freezing a steak does not affect its taste as long as it has not been freezer burnt. Freezer burnt meat does not taste good. 

How To Freeze Steak to Avoid Freezer Burn.

The main points is to avoid freezer burn …

  • Remove as much air as possible from the freezer bag. 
  • Make sure there are no holes in your freezer bag.
  • Keep the frozen steak at a steady temp as close to 0 as possible. 

Is It Safe to Refreeze Thawed Meat That Has Already Been Frozen?

According to the USDA, it is safe as long as the meat has been handled properly. That said, my mother always taught me to NEVER do this. It is BEST to cook the meat and then freeze it if you are needing to store it for a while. 

Meat that has been refrozen after being thawed without being cooked first will lose some of its textural qualities and may have a slightly funny taste. Here is a great reference on freezing and refrigerating foods of various types. 

Tips and Tricks for How To Freeze Steak

  • Use good quality freezer bags (this doesn't necessarily mean name brand) for how to freeze steak. Just check to make sure that the bag feels heavy and thick in your hand and that the seal works very well.
  • It's so easy to use the type of bag with the zippers, but I've had more bag failures with the zipper bags than with the press and seal type bags. 
  • Buy yourself a sharpie marker to keep in the kitchen in your "junk" drawer OR tape it to the front of your freezer bag box. Then you'll always have one. 
  • The flater that you can make the bag, the better for saving space in your freezer. 
  • When putting things in the freezer, put the newer things on the bottom of the stack so that the older things are near the top and you'll use those first. 
  • Squeeze air out of the bag after you put the meat into the bag by rolling it up. Air in the bag will equal freezer burn later. This is how to freeze steak.

PRO TIP:  Label the bag BEFORE you put the food in the bag. It's so much easier to write on a bag with nothing in it BEFORE it has water or grease on it.
